Dispatch of K.L.G. E.25 spark plugs with 'Curundite' insulators for testing on Phantom III trials cars.

Identifier  ExFiles\Box 162\4\  img256
Date  20th February 1937
  
6001b

W/LH.{Mr Haworth}
To J.L.E. from Rm{William Robotham - Chief Engineer}/Wst.
c. to Sg.{Arthur F. Sidgreaves - MD}

Rm{William Robotham - Chief Engineer}/Wst.3/AP.20.2.37.

PHANTOM III. TRIALS CARS.

We are sending 24 K.L.G. E.25 plugs for test on one of the above cars, and will be pleased to hear your comments on same.

These plugs are the new K.L.G. Ceramic type with 'Curundite' insulators.
